What is Czech Koruna
The Czech Koruna, often abbreviated as CZK, is the official currency of the Czech Republic, a country located in Central Europe. It is a fiat currency, which means it is not backed by a physical commodity like gold or silver, but rather by the trust and confidence of the people who use it. This is a common characteristic of most modern currencies. The Czech National Bank, the central bank of the Czech Republic, is responsible for issuing and regulating the Czech Koruna.
In everyday economic life, the Czech Koruna is used for all types of transactions, from buying goods and services in shops to paying wages and salaries. The currency plays a crucial role in the Czech economy, affecting everything from the prices of goods and services to the rate of economic growth. The value of the Czech Koruna relative to other currencies can also impact the country's trade balance, as it influences the price of Czech exports and imports.
The Czech Koruna is subdivided into smaller units known as haléřů, although these are no longer in active use due to their low value. Banknotes come in denominations of 100, 200, 500, 1000, 2000, and 5000 korun, while coins are issued in 1, 2, 5, 10, 20, and 50 korun denominations.
While the Czech Republic is a member of the European Union, it has not adopted the Euro as its currency. This is largely due to the country's decision to maintain its own monetary policy and control over its currency. The decision to adopt the Euro would require a public referendum, and so far, there is no clear timeline for when this might happen.

What Influences the DF to CZK Exchange Rate?
The exchange rate between dForce (DF) and Czech Koruna (CZK) is influenced by a range of global and local factors. If you are interested to trade or invest in DF, understanding what drives this conversion can help you make more informed decisions.
1. Market Sentiment and News
Crypto markets are highly reactive to sentiment. Positive developments, such as major partnerships, increased adoption, or favorable media coverage-can drive up demand and increase the DF to CZK rate. On the flip side, negative press, security issues, or regulatory actions may result in price drops.
2. Government Regulation and Legal Clarity
The regulatory environment in both the cryptocurrency's key markets and CZK-issuing countries plays a major role. Supportive policies can increase confidence and adoption, pushing rates higher. On the other hand, restrictive or unclear regulations often introduce market uncertainty.
3. CZK Currency Strength and Local Economic Indicators
Traditional economic factors like interest rates, inflation, and GDP performance directly influence CZK's strength. When CZK weakens due to inflation or policy changes, investors may seek alternatives like DF, increasing demand and raising the exchange rate.
4. Blockchain and Technology Developments
For cryptocurrencies like dForce, improvements in technology such as network upgrades, scalability solutions, or ecosystem expansion-often lead to increased adoption and price growth. These changes can enhance investor confidence and influence exchange rates positively.
5. Global Financial Events and Market Trends
Macroeconomic trends such as global inflation fears, geopolitical tensions, or changes in interest rates by central banks can prompt a shift toward digital assets as a store of value. In uncertain times, demand for DF may rise, impacting its conversion to CZK.
